Arsenal: "Robot Pires", official chatbot available on Facebook Messenger, Skype, Slack and Telegram

Paris - Published Tuesday, October 30, 2018 - 12:10 - News #132238
Arsenal FC (Premier League) have launched an official chatbot on the FacebookMessenger, Skype, Slack and Telegram messaging platforms, according to the London (ENG) club on 24/10/2018. The club's chatbot has been named "Robot Pires", in reference to Robert Pirès, the former French international and Arsenal FC striker.

The chatbot was developed by the American artificial intelligence platform GameOn. "Fans can personalise their experience by following their favourite topics and players, customising their match alerts, getting targeted news and updates, and allowing for real-time reactions and engagement, direct from the club," said Arsenal FC.

"As the way fans engage with teams evolves, there are more exciting and dynamic ways we can craft chatbots. Chatbots are a great way for clubs to evolve their platforms for speaking to fans," said Alex Beckman, founder and CEO of GameOn.
